| Activity | Immediate | Optimistic | Most | Pessimistic | Standard | Variance |
| Predecessor | Likely | Deviation | ||||
| A | -- | 4 | 5 | 6 | 0.333 | 0.111 |
| B | -- | 12 | 15 | 18 | 1 | 1 |
| C | A | 2 | 8 | 14 | 2 | 4 |
| D | A | 5 | 5 | 5 | 0 | 0 |
| E | B, C | 6 | 7 | 8 | 0.333 | 0.111 |
| a) | Which activities are on the critical path? | ||||
| b) | compute the slack time for activity E | ||||
| c) | What is the completion time and variance of the critical path? | ||||
| d) | Which activity has the most slack? | ||||
| e) | Assume the normal distribution is appropriate to use to determine the probability of finishing by a particular time. What is the probability that the project is finished in 24 weeks or fewer? (Round to two decimals.) | ||||
| f) | what is the latest possible time that C may be started without delaying completion of the project? | ||||
